香港云服务器性能调优是确保应用高效运行的关键,本指南涵盖了性能调优的多个方面:,1. **硬件选择**:选配适当的CPU、内存、存储和网络设备,以满足业务需求。,2. **操作系统优化**:调整内核参数、文件句柄限制等,提升系统性能。,3. **数据库优化**:选择合适的数据库,优化查询语句和索引,使用缓存减轻压力。,4. **应用层优化**:减少不必要的服务请求,压缩数据传输,利用CDN加速内容分发。,通过这些措施,可显著提升云服务器的性能和稳定性。
随着互联网技术的飞速发展,云服务器已成为众多企业和个人开发者的首选,在香港这座国际化的金融中心和科技城市,云服务器的性能调优更是至关重要,本文将为您提供一份详尽的香港云服务器性能调优指南,帮助您在云端构建高效、稳定的应用环境。
硬件选型与配置
硬件是云服务器性能的基础,在选择云服务器时,应充分考虑CPU、内存、存储和网络等关键硬件参数,以确保满足您的业务需求。
-
CPU:选择具有高核心数和线程数的CPU,以提高并发处理能力和数据处理速度。
-
内存:根据您的应用场景和并发量,配置足够的内存容量,避免内存不足导致的性能瓶颈。
-
存储:采用高速、高容量的SSD硬盘,确保快速读写和数据安全。
-
网络:配置千兆或万兆以太网接口,保障数据传输的高效与稳定。
操作系统与虚拟化
操作系统和虚拟化技术是云服务器性能调优的重要环节。
-
操作系统:选择稳定性强、安全性高的操作系统,如Linux的Ubuntu、CentOS等。
-
虚拟化:利用KVM、Xen等虚拟化技术,实现资源的隔离与共享,提高资源利用率。
应用程序优化
针对具体的应用程序,进行性能调优至关重要。
-
代码优化:采用高效的数据结构和算法,减少不必要的计算和内存开销。
-
数据库优化:合理设计数据库结构,利用索引、缓存等技术提高查询效率。
-
缓存策略:实施合理的缓存策略,减少对后端服务的压力,提高响应速度。
网络性能优化
网络性能直接影响云服务器的性能表现。
-
带宽设置:根据业务需求,合理配置带宽大小,避免带宽不足导致的拥塞问题。
-
CDN加速分发网络(CDN)技术,将静态资源缓存到离用户最近的节点,提高访问速度。
-
安全组配置:合理设置安全组规则,限制不必要的网络访问,保障服务器安全。
监控与故障排查
完善的监控和故障排查机制是确保云服务器稳定运行的关键。
-
性能监控:利用云服务提供商提供的监控工具,实时监控CPU、内存、存储和网络等关键指标。
-
日志分析:定期分析系统日志和应用日志,发现潜在的性能问题和故障线索。
-
应急响应:建立应急预案,对突发事件进行快速响应和处理,减少业务中断时间。
总结与展望
云服务器性能调优是一个持续的过程,需要综合考虑硬件、操作系统、应用程序、网络等多个方面,通过本文提供的指南和建议,希望能帮助您在香港云服务器上构建高效、稳定的应用环境,展望未来,随着技术的不断进步和业务需求的持续增长,云服务器性能调优将面临更多挑战和机遇,我们将继续关注行业动态和技术发展,为您提供更全面、更深入的性能调优知识和实践经验。